Forty four cases with parotid gland tumors, treated during the past ten years in our clinic, were reported. They were reviewed according to sex and age distributions, clinical history, symptoms, diagnostic procedures, therapeutic methods, and prognosis. Among the 44 cases, 31 were benign and 13 malignant. Eighty percent of the benign tumors were the pleomorphic adenoma (25 cases). The vast majority of them were the female patients. Parotid gland tumors can be classified into the various types besides benign or malignant. Spontaneous pain, tenderness and facial palsy were found to accompany only malignant tumor, and therefore are very useful in preoperative diagnosis for malignancy. Sialo graphy, scintigraphy, computed tomography and ultrasonics are also useful for preoper ative diagnosis. Combined treatment with surgery, radiotherapy, chemotherapy and im munotherapy was indispensable to the management of malignant tumors.
